Please define sign codes ? and flyers?

The RIOC buses are currently set up under three categories for the morning rush hours.

(a) Octagon Express - which run straight from the Octagon residentail complex down to the subway with no stops;
(b) Octagon Local - self explanatory; and
(c) Firehouse Local - which runs locally from the Firehouse / 40 River Road down through the subway / tram stops as a local.

The Octagon Express is funded by the Octagon. I am unsure if fully or partially.
